Transaction 93febdd51e054bde6aa69e9d55d91a01bf0265b9f7168da72a24d665fbaffe59
1 Input
1 Output
-
93febdd51e054bde6aa69e9d55d91a01bf0265b9f7168da72a24d665fbaffe59:0
- value
- 163554736
- script pubkey
- OP_0 OP_PUSHBYTES_20 84ad457a398af208a3dbbf44d1760dd60e6b1c75
- address
- bc1qsjk5273e3teq3g7mhazdzasd6c8xk8r4zcm3e8